Subject: SN1993J, data from India
I am retransmitting to you for diffusion the following observations received
today from Dr. T.P. Prabhu and colleagues working at the Vainu Bappu
Observatory, Kavalur, India. They are reduced to the UBVRcIc system and
fill the gap between Europe and Japan.

Supernova 1993J: CCD photometric results.
Y. D. Mayya, T. P. Prabhu, Ram Sagar, A. Subramaniam, A. K. Pati,
Indian Institute of Astrophysics, Bangalore 560034, India
K. P. Singh, Tata Institute of Fundamental Research, Bombay 400005, India
Gopal-Krishna, National Centre for Radio Astrophysics, Pune 411007, India
Telescope : 2.3m reflector, Vainu Bappu Observatory, Kavalur, India
Instrument: Prime Focus CCD camera with GEC 8603 chip
Method : Differential photometry with star B as standard. Correction
for colour coefficient in transformation equations is made.
Date V B-V V-R V-I
1993
APR 14.68 10.957 0.521 0.390
APR 15.67 10.898 0.497 0.397
APR 16.68 10.865 0.530 0.425
APR 17.65 10.869 0.630 0.406
APR 18.62 10.847 0.576 0.396
APR 19.62 10.885 0.675 0.426
APR 21.61 10.976 0.780 0.473 0.520
APR 22.59 11.049 0.876 0.475
APR 24.60 11.267 0.935 0.557 0.637
MAY 21.61 12.473 1.269 0.686
MAY 23.64 12.538 1.392 0.707
Star B 11.900 0.500 0.300 0.600 Comparison; assumed mag
+/-0.018 +/-0.023 +/-0.008 +/-0.008 rms of correction
Star A 11.407 0.539 0.306 0.604 Check star; derived mag
+/-0.016 +/-0.021 +/-0.022 0.010 rms of derived mag
